Why did baji join valhalla?

Baji’s decision to join Valhalla in “Tokyo Revengers” is a pivotal moment in the series, marked by a complex interplay of factors that ultimately led to tragic consequences. This article delves into the reasons behind Baji’s choice, examining the underlying motivations and the impact of his decision on the narrative.

Protection of Mikey

At the core of Baji’s decision was his unwavering loyalty and protectiveness towards Mikey. Baji viewed Mikey as a younger brother and felt a deep-seated responsibility to ensure his safety. Believing that joining Valhalla would provide him with a better understanding of their plans, Baji hoped to anticipate and thwart any potential threats to Mikey.

Misunderstanding and manipulation

Kisaki Tetta, the series’ cunning antagonist, played a pivotal role in manipulating Baji into joining Valhalla. By exploiting Baji’s vulnerabilities and fears for Mikey’s safety, Kisaki painted a distorted picture of the situation, convincing Baji that joining Valhalla was the only way to protect his friend. This manipulation, combined with Baji’s own emotional turmoil, clouded his judgment and led him down a dangerous path.

Desire for a fresh start

Baji’s life had been marked by violence and loss, leaving him emotionally scarred. Joining Valhalla may have seemed like an opportunity to escape his troubled past and start anew. He may have believed that by aligning himself with a powerful organization, he could forge a new identity and leave behind the pain of his past.

Internal conflict and a desire for validation

Baji was a complex character, torn between his desire to do what was right and his longing for acceptance. Joining Valhalla may have represented a way for him to prove himself and gain the recognition he craved. However, this decision ultimately conflicted with his core values and led to a deep sense of internal turmoil.

The allure of power

Baji’s desire to protect those he cared about was fueled by a longing for power. He believed that by becoming stronger, he could better safeguard his loved ones. Joining Valhalla, an organization known for its strength and influence, seemed like a logical step in achieving this goal.

Conclusion

Ultimately, Baji’s decision to join Valhalla was a tragic mistake. Driven by his desire to protect Mikey and his own internal struggles, he made a choice that had devastating consequences. This decision not only harmed himself but also had a profound impact on his friends and the Tokyo Manji Gang.

In conclusion, Baji’s reasons for joining Valhalla were multifaceted, stemming from his deep-rooted affection for Mikey, manipulation by Kisaki Tetta, a desire for a fresh start, internal conflict, and a yearning for power. This complex interplay of factors led him down a dark path, revealing the depth and complexity of his character.
